Diminutive Xiong aiming even higher
By Murray Greig | China Daily | Updated: 2014-02-04 07:50
WBC strawweight champion wants to unify titles and then battle compatriot
Xiong Chaozhong is small in stature, but on Wednesday night in Haikou, Hainan province, he will try to solidify his standing as the biggest man in Chinese boxing.
With a potential television audience of several hundred million watching live on CCTV-5, the stakes will be high for Xiong (22-4-1, 12 KOs) when he enters the ring at Haikou City Hall to defend his World Boxing Council strawweight title in a 12-rounder against Mexico's Oswaldo Novoa (12-4-1, 7 KOs).
